What Factors Should You Consider When Choosing a Country?

When deciding on a destination for a bachelor's program abroad, what key factors should one consider? To begin, the educational quality is the highest priority; prospective students should research academic rankings, professor credentials, and the curriculum's relevance to their field of study. Furthermore, language serves as a critical consideration; students need to assess whether they are at ease learning in the regional language or if English-taught programs exist.

Cultural compatibility is another important consideration; comprehending the local society, traditions, and way of life can significantly shape the overall experience. Additionally, safety and political stability are essential considerations; students ought to research the nation's safety record and prevailing political environment. In addition, distance from home and travel possibilities can impact individual preferences and overall contentment. By carefully considering these elements, students can arrive at well-informed choices that correspond with their academic and personal goals.

Types Of Scholarships Offered

When seeking a bachelor's degree abroad is often a life-changing journey, being aware of the various scholarships offered is essential for managing costs. A wide range of scholarships address diverse needs and situations. Scholarships based on merit recognize outstanding academic performance, while need-driven scholarships aid students experiencing financial hardship. Certain universities provide dedicated scholarships for international students to promote inclusivity. Moreover, state-sponsored scholarships like Fulbright or Chevening offer substantial assistance for overseas education. Non-governmental organizations and foundations additionally provide scholarships targeting particular disciplines or geographic areas. In addition, certain nations provide scholarships to draw international talent, increasing the accessibility of higher education. Investigating these opportunities can significantly reduce the financial strain of international education.

Types Of Student Visas

Maneuvering through the realm of student visas is essential for anyone considering a college education abroad. Different countries offer multiple kinds of student visas, all featuring unique criteria and benefits. For illustration, the F-1 visa in the United States permits students to engage in full-time studies, while the Tier 4 visa in the United Kingdom fulfills a comparable role. Some countries, like Canada and Australia, offer dedicated visas allowing students to engage in part-time employment while studying. Additionally, some countries may impose particular conditions based on how long the course runs or whether the educational institution holds proper accreditation. Recognizing these variations is essential for prospective students to guarantee compliance and select the right visa for their academic pursuits.

Overview of the Application Process

Navigating the application process for a student visa involves careful attention to the specific requirements of the chosen country. Every country has distinct regulations, documentation, and timelines that must be followed. Generally, candidates must gather essential documents such as proof of admission, financial statements, and health insurance. Additionally, some countries may require a language proficiency test or a medical examination.

It is important for prospective students to start the application process early, as visa processing times can differ significantly. Familiarizing oneself with the embassy or consulate's guidelines is also critical, as they provide detailed instructions and any updates on requirements. Ultimately, thorough preparation guarantees a smoother passage to studying abroad.

What Health Insurance Is Required for Studying Abroad?

Students pursuing education overseas typically require thorough medical insurance that covers medical emergencies, hospitalization, and repatriation. It is important to verify the host nation's insurance requirements and verify the policy includes coverage for routine care and pre-existing conditions.
